What Is Quality Of Patient Care?
In healthcare, the quality of care is an indication of the degree to which a health system can meet the health needs of an individual or population. In order to attain universal health coverage, it depends on evidence-based professional knowledge.

What Does It Mean To Provide Patient Care?
Providing care that is respectful and responsive to a patient’s specific needs, preferences, and values is what defines patient-centered care. It also ensures that patient values guide all decision making throughout the hospital setting. An individual who wants to partner with their healthcare requires a truly collaborative effort.
